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 has a general score of 74.6, which is much better than the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70's general score of 63.3. Both of these devices use the same Android 4.4 OS, so they should provide the user all the same OS features. The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 design is somewhat thinner and just a little bit lighter than the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70.
The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70 has a little better hardware performance than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1, because although it has less RAM, and they both have 4 cpu cores, the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70 also counts with a faster graphics processing unit and a 64-bit processing unit. The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 counts with a bit better looking screen than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70, and although they both have a display of the same size, the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 also has more pixels per screen inch and a higher 1600 x 2560 resolution.
Samsung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 features a much bigger memory for apps and games than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70, because it has a slot for external memory cards that admits a maximum of 64 GB and 32 GB internal memory capacity. The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70's camera is very similar to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1's camera, both of them have a 8 mega pixels resolution back facing camera.
Samsung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 counts with a bit longer battery life than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70, because it has 8220mAh of battery capacity instead of 7200mAh.
The Galaxy Tab Pro 10.1 costs a little more than the Lenovo TAB 2 A10-70, but you can get a better tablet for that few more dollars.
